2 RepliesEdited by Mister Nice Guy: 7/6/2015 6:39:36 PM1. All level advantages disabled 2. Non-elemental and reforgeble weapons as rewards (seriously, why not allow me to reforge Jewels or Messenger if I want to? 3. Reaching mercury only requires 9 wins, having access to the "flawless tier" (see below) requires a flawless run 4. Move flawless tier as an added layer after reaching mercury, where you go against other mercury players of similar skill/rank and you get a very special emblem only accessible to those players, and an opportunity to CHOOSE what weapon you want from a select vendor (instead of a chest, leave the RNG chest to players who could not get flawless on this tier) 5. Remove exotic weapons from the flawless competition tier (this is a long term vision to possibly making community tournament streams off said tier) 6. Add an spectator mode to watch your friends and their team from the roster within game (similar to how you can see others play while you're a dead ghost) 7. Rotate team spawns at mid-match (at least) 8. Saving the best for last: [b]MOST IMPORTANTLY, DEDICATED SERVERS[/b] I think that's all I can think of. Maybe #1 to apply only to the flawless tier, if people really care about having that light-level edge, but we really need the "flawless tier" bit to make it truly competitive and brag-worthy.
